Established in 1972, Powder Mountain is one of the most treasured ski resorts in North America, renowned for world-class terrain, endless pristine powder, and uncrowded expansive beauty. Located in the western United States east of Eden, Utah, stretching between Weber and Cache counties in the Wasatch Range, Powder covers 12,000 acres, and is one of the largest ski resorts in the U.S..
